How do you read a 64th ruler?

The 1/64 is halfway of the mark you just made from the start of the ruler and 3/64 is half way between the 1/32nd and the 1/16th mark on the ruler. IE all 3 marks are all before the first 16th mark on all rulers. Now 5/64ths is 1/4 the distance between the first and second mark.

What is 1/64 inches as a decimal?

To convert the fractional 1/64 inches to decimal, we simply divide the numerator by the denominator. Here is the math to illustrate: Thus, 1/64 inches to decimal is 0.015625. Moving on, note that there are 12 inches in a foot.
